ROCHESTER, Minn. — Police in Rochester are looking for a suspect who stole a shuttle van early Friday.

Around 2:45 a.m., authorities say they received a report of a stolen van from the 800 block of Civic Center Drive Northwest. The van was left running outside a transportation business while customers were inside the business. 

The suspect was seen driving on Highway 52 around 3 a.m. and sped up near Zumbrota when authorities tried to stop them. 

Police say spike strips were used and the van came to a stop near the border of Goodhue and Dakota Counties. 

The suspect ran into a field and has not been located. 

According to authorities, there is no clear threat to the area.
